Topic: Describe a bar chard.

The chart illustrates the number of tourists who visited the city of Dover and Troy in each of the four seasons of 2014.

It can be seen that the number of tourists visiting Dover was higher than that of Troy. In the spring, both Dover and Troy have the fewest visitors, while in the summer, the number of tourists who visited Troy was the highest compared to Dover in the winter.

In Dover, most tourists travel in the winter, about 25,000 tourists compared to only 5,000 tourists in spring. There was a steady increase in the number of visitors from spring to fall, from 5,000 to 15,000 tourists, but later rose significantly to 25,000 tourists in the winter.

In the city of Troy, most tourists visited in the summer (over 20,000 tourists), while in the spring, the number of tourists was just slightly below 5,000, which was the fewest visitors in Troy in all four seasons. From spring to summer, there was a considerable increase in tourists visiting Troy, from under 5,000 to over 20,000 visitors. However, the number dropped slightly in the fall (20,000 tourists) and significantly in winter (5,000 tourists).
